Transaction 65d8ea3ac165037e95a1b09788e5c50a8590220cbbc3ae23a968f5e08dd9a690
1 Input
2 Outputs
- 65d8ea3ac165037e95a1b09788e5c50a8590220cbbc3ae23a968f5e08dd9a690:0
- 65d8ea3ac165037e95a1b09788e5c50a8590220cbbc3ae23a968f5e08dd9a690:1
value 3679295
address 33NNZXT6RUAPqpwGVo1sTeRyrpF8i9i128
value 1212497
address 1PoFe95vYX893nrPMjRuPd5KjGw6r8uPur